Unmanned Ground Vehicle (UGV) Market (USD Million)
Unmanned Ground Vehicle (UGV) Market was valued at USD 3,874.44 million in the year 2024. The size of this market is expected to increase to USD 6,303.37 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 7.2%.

Unmanned Ground Vehicle (UGV) Market Key Takeaways
-
The UGV Market is accelerating as defence and security forces, as well as commercial industries, increasingly deploy unmanned ground systems to carry out high-risk, repetitive or inaccessible tasks.
-
Tele-operated platforms currently dominate the market due to their proven reliability, while the shift toward autonomous UGVs using AI, sensor fusion and advanced navigation is opening new value-added opportunities.
-
The primary application remains in military & defence operations for roles such as reconnaissance, explosive ordnance disposal, logistics and perimeter security, while the commercial segment (mining, agriculture, logistics) is emerging as a fast-growing frontier.
-
North America holds a significant share of the global market thanks to high defence spending, extensive R&D infrastructure and early adoption of robotic ground systems, with Asia-Pacific emerging as a high-growth regional zone.
-
Key enablers include improvements in battery & power systems, modular payload architectures, secure connectivity and software-defined upgrades that enable UGVs to be reconfigured for multiple missions.
-
Major challenges include high unit and integration costs, the complexity of navigating regulatory and ethical frameworks for autonomous weapons, interoperability issues with existing systems, and operational risks in harsh terrain.
-
Market leaders are increasingly focusing on offering end-to-end solutions—hardware, software, sensors, services—and specialising in fleet-management, data analytics and lifecycle support to differentiate from commodity-driven competition.
Unmanned Ground Vehicle (UGV) Market Recent Developments
-
In July 2023, Ghost Robotics unveiled the Vision 60 quadruped robot, designed for military and security applications. The robot integrates multiple sensors and payloads, including cameras and weapons, providing enhanced operational versatility and advanced mission capability.
-
In May 2023, Clearpath Robotics launched the Husky UGV, a rugged unmanned ground vehicle built for military and industrial operations. It supports a diverse range of sensors and payloads, offering exceptional adaptability and performance across varied mission requirements.

Unmanned Ground Vehicle (UGV) Market, Segmentation by Operation
The UGV market is segmented by operation into Teleoperated, Autonomous, and Tethered modes. The evolution of control technologies and integration of artificial intelligence have significantly influenced these operational segments. Growing defense modernization programs and the rising need for remote operations in hazardous environments are major drivers for this segment’s growth.
Teleoperated
Teleoperated UGVs dominate the current market due to their reliability and operator control flexibility. They are extensively used for bomb disposal, surveillance, and rescue operations. Technological enhancements in long-range communication and control systems continue to improve their performance and penetration.
Autonomous
Autonomous UGVs are witnessing rapid adoption driven by advancements in AI-based navigation and sensor fusion. These vehicles are increasingly deployed in both defense and commercial sectors for logistics and reconnaissance missions, demonstrating a projected growth rate exceeding 15% CAGR over the forecast period.
Tethered
Tethered UGVs are primarily used in confined or hazardous environments where uninterrupted power and data transmission are critical. Though limited in mobility, their application in inspection, nuclear response, and tunnel monitoring remains essential due to their reliability and safety.
Unmanned Ground Vehicle (UGV) Market, Segmentation by Mobility
The mobility-based segmentation includes Wheels, Tracks, Legs, and Hybrid systems. The choice of mobility mechanism depends on operational terrain, payload capacity, and mission requirements. Each configuration offers specific benefits in terms of maneuverability, stability, and energy efficiency, shaping the competitive dynamics of the global UGV landscape.
Wheels
Wheeled UGVs are preferred for smooth and urban terrains, offering speed and cost efficiency. Their growing adoption in logistics and warehouse automation reflects the rising trend toward industrial robotics integration.
Tracks
Tracked UGVs deliver superior traction and stability on uneven or rough terrains, making them indispensable in military and defense applications. They account for a significant share of the global market, driven by increasing investments in cross-country mobility solutions.
Legs
Legged UGVs represent the next generation of mobility, mimicking biological movement for navigation across complex surfaces. Their integration in exploration and disaster response missions is expanding, supported by innovations in dynamic balancing and actuator technology.
Hybrid
Hybrid mobility UGVs combine multiple movement mechanisms to achieve versatility and terrain adaptability. These systems are emerging as ideal solutions for multi-environment operations, enhancing efficiency and mission flexibility.
Unmanned Ground Vehicle (UGV) Market, Segmentation by Size
The market is divided into Small, Medium, Large, and Very Large UGVs based on size. Size directly influences payload, endurance, and deployment scenarios, making it a key factor in the technological evolution and adoption of UGVs across industries.
Small
Small UGVs are highly maneuverable and cost-effective, widely used for surveillance, inspection, and research purposes. Their portability and modular architecture make them vital in both defense and commercial applications.
Medium
Medium UGVs balance operational range and payload capacity. Their growing use in logistics, agricultural automation, and mid-level combat support reflects expanding cross-sector demand.
Large
Large UGVs offer enhanced endurance and heavy payload capability, making them suitable for combat, supply transport, and heavy-duty missions. Their increasing deployment in tactical environments supports defense modernization efforts.
Very Large
Very Large UGVs serve strategic operations such as combat logistics, mobile artillery support, and terrain reconnaissance. Although costly, their robust power systems and superior navigation features signify technological advancement in unmanned warfare.
Unmanned Ground Vehicle (UGV) Market, Segmentation by System
System-based segmentation includes Payloads, Navigation & Control System, Power System, and Others. Continuous R&D efforts and system integration improvements are enhancing UGV functionality, autonomy, and energy efficiency across these segments.
Payloads
Payload systems determine mission capability, enabling UGVs to perform tasks ranging from surveillance to material transport. The integration of multi-sensor payloads and high-definition cameras continues to expand their operational versatility.
Navigation & Control System
Navigation & Control Systems form the core of UGV autonomy. Advances in GPS-denied navigation, AI-based path planning, and obstacle avoidance are driving major breakthroughs, enhancing reliability and reducing human intervention.
Power System
Power Systems are critical for sustained operation. Innovations in battery energy density and hybrid power solutions are improving efficiency and operational runtime, particularly for defense and industrial uses.
Others
This segment encompasses communication, software, and hardware integration components that enhance the functionality and interoperability of UGVs within broader autonomous ecosystems.
Unmanned Ground Vehicle (UGV) Market, Segmentation by Application
The application-based segmentation categorizes the market into Commercial, Military, and Government & Law Enforcement. Each application segment showcases distinct technological and operational priorities, shaping the market’s trajectory through targeted innovation and deployment strategies.
Commercial
Commercial UGVs are experiencing rising demand across industries seeking automation, safety, and cost reduction. The segment benefits from increased deployment in agriculture, mining, and logistics.
-
Agriculture
Agricultural UGVs are revolutionizing crop monitoring, soil management, and autonomous farming operations. They enable enhanced precision agriculture and reduced labor dependency, improving overall yield and sustainability.
-
Manufacturing
UGVs in manufacturing settings streamline material handling and inspection, integrating with industrial automation frameworks for improved efficiency and reduced downtime.
-
Mining
Mining UGVs enhance safety by reducing human exposure to hazardous conditions. Their role in autonomous haulage and exploration is transforming productivity and cost structures in the mining sector.
-
Supply Chain
Supply chain UGVs optimize warehouse management, last-mile delivery, and logistics automation. This segment’s growth is fueled by increasing demand for real-time tracking and smart mobility solutions.
-
Others
This category includes miscellaneous industrial and service-based UGV applications that enhance operational flexibility and efficiency in niche domains.
Military
Military UGVs represent the largest share of the global market, driven by continuous defense spending and modernization initiatives. These systems provide tactical advantages in combat, reconnaissance, and logistics support.
-
Explosive Ordnance Disposal
UGVs designed for explosive ordnance disposal mitigate human risk during hazardous operations, employing precision handling tools and advanced vision systems.
-
Equipment Carrying
Equipment-carrying UGVs are vital for transporting supplies and gear in challenging terrains, improving mission efficiency and troop safety.
-
Forward Reconnaissance
Reconnaissance UGVs enhance situational awareness and intelligence gathering, integrating with real-time data systems for strategic operations.
-
Mobile Weapon Platform
Weaponized UGVs deliver precision targeting and remote firing capabilities, contributing to autonomous defense operations with minimized personnel exposure.
-
Combat
Combat UGVs operate alongside manned systems, providing fire support and tactical advantage. This sub-segment is rapidly growing with increasing investments in AI-enabled battlefield systems.
-
Surveillance & Reconnaissance
Surveillance UGVs are essential for border monitoring and intelligence missions, equipped with multi-sensor payloads and long-range communication tools.
-
Others
This category includes specialized military support UGVs used for engineering, supply chain, and recovery operations in extreme environments.
Government & Law Enforcement
UGVs for Government & Law Enforcement are increasingly deployed in emergency response and public safety. Their versatility enhances operational efficiency across multiple civil sectors.
-
Urban Search & Rescue
UGVs designed for search and rescue operations improve access to disaster sites, enabling rapid response and victim detection in hazardous zones.
-
Firefighting
Firefighting UGVs operate in high-temperature environments where human intervention is unsafe, improving efficiency in fire suppression efforts.
-
Nuclear Response
Nuclear response UGVs ensure safety in contaminated zones by performing inspections, sample retrieval, and containment tasks with minimal human exposure.
-
Crowd Control
Crowd control UGVs assist in surveillance and non-lethal intervention during large public gatherings, enhancing safety and response coordination.
-
Others
This includes specialized law enforcement robots for inspection, patrolling, and evidence collection in sensitive or risky operations.
Unmanned Ground Vehicle (UGV) Market, Segmentation by Geography
In this report, the Unmanned Ground Vehicle (UGV) Market has been segmented by Geography into five regions: North America, Europe, Asia Pacific, Middle East and Africa and Latin America.
Regions and Countries Analyzed in this Report
North America
North America dominates the global UGV market, supported by high defense budgets, extensive R&D investments, and early technology adoption. The U.S. accounts for the majority share due to large-scale military programs and increasing integration of autonomous systems in both defense and commercial sectors.
Europe
Europe exhibits strong growth potential with leading players in defense robotics and automation technologies. Collaborations under the European Defense Fund and emphasis on cross-border defense innovation continue to accelerate regional adoption of UGV systems.
Asia Pacific
Asia Pacific is expected to record the fastest growth due to rising defense expenditures in China, India, and Japan. The expansion of industrial automation and smart mobility initiatives further boosts the regional market outlook.
Middle East and Africa
Middle East and Africa are emerging markets for UGVs, primarily driven by security modernization and counter-terrorism programs. Increasing deployment of unmanned systems in oil & gas inspection and border surveillance is enhancing adoption rates.
Latin America
Latin America is gradually embracing UGV technologies in law enforcement, agriculture, and mining sectors. The region’s increasing industrial automation and defense collaborations are expected to strengthen market growth over the forecast period.
